Uniform Delivery — Harlow Bend Depot. The first batch of branded uniforms from Stitchport Supply arrives Thursday morning. Count the cartons against the packing list, confirm sizes match the staffing sheet, and store everything in the locked cage by the break room. Do not distribute items until the depot opening date is confirmed. The courier must receive the following instruction verbatim at hand-over:

dispatch memo: the eliath belael courier leaves the praox ledger at gate 8841 under passcode 017589

Before promoting a Ferndrift release, run the podcast feed validator against the staging catalog. The validator flags malformed episode GUIDs, oversized artwork, and enclosure MIME mismatches; any error-level finding blocks the release. Warnings about episode descriptions may be waived with sign-off from the content lead. If the validator hangs past ten minutes, the Quillbank ingest queue is likely backed up — drain it and rerun. Record the validator run by noting the trace token below.

pipeline stamp: htk9_ce63042d9

Revenue dependence on our largest client, Helvane Group, has risen to a level that warrants structured mitigation. Should Helvane reduce its Quartzline commitments, regional margins in the Dornfield territory would compress materially. Management has modeled three diversification scenarios, each assuming phased onboarding of mid-market accounts over four quarters. We recommend the board endorse scenario two at the next session. The confidential planning note relevant to this decision follows below.

internal memo for yajef-tajeg: The renewal with Ralaelek Group closes at $2 million a year, 15 percent above the last contract. Project Zorix slips by two quarters because of the tooling delay.

Deep-link routing on Wrenfall Mobile is handled by the Pathgate resolver. Release builds must register the route manifest with Pathgate before cutover, or links fall back to the web shell. Verify the manifest hash matches the release tag. Registration calls require the Pathgate staging credential, shown below.

API key for yahig-tadup: kto7_ubizbYm

**Vendor note: Inkmill markdown pipeline**

Rendering for Parchway docs is outsourced to Inkmill under an annual contract, renewing each March. They handle sanitization and PDF export; we own the upload queue. SLA: 4-hour response on rendering failures. Escalate only after two failed retries. Their support desk is reachable at the address below.

billing contact of hahaf-baguf = zorael.tammir.jorius@sivrelhq.internal